Carly Pearce quashes ‘Satanism’ accusations with confession of devout faith

Carly Pearce has spoken out about accusations that she is promoting satanism after a photo of her trended online.

The Photo in question is a post she made on X, formerly Twitter. In it, she is seen standing on a blurred spot marked “668”. Because the last digit is fainter than the previous two, people online speculated that it was the infamous “666” symbol.

Pearce clarified the confusion in a quote tweet.

“I’ve seen too many comments saying this is some kind of “hint” towards 666 or the devil so I’m not commenting. First of all, this is where my tour bus parked at the CMA festival and I believe that’s 668,” she said. disclosure.

Pearce then made a huge profession of faith, clearing the air once and for all.

“I am a devout Christian who takes pride in using my platform to point people to JESUS. So for anyone wondering… absolutely NO information no basic message except a girl excited to perform on the big stage,” she said, adding a white heart and praying emoji.

The clarification comes weeks after she revealed on Instagram that she had been diagnosed with a heart condition called Pericarditis.

After her diagnosis, Pearce revealed that it was in her “best interests” to “change up” her programs a bit. While Pearce didn’t specifically detail which parts of her program would be different, she assured them it was done to control her heart rate during performance.
